在使用GitHub的过程中,许多用户会遇到图片加载不出来的情况。本文将详细探讨该问题的原因、解决方案以及相关的常见问题,以帮助用户高效地解决这一困扰。
目录
问题概述
在GitHub中,尤其是在使用GitHub Pages或进行项目展示时,图片加载不出来是一个常见的问题。这可能影响项目的展示效果,甚至影响用户的使用体验。因此,了解原因并找到解决方案至关重要。
图片加载不出来的常见原因
权限设置问题
在GitHub中,如果你的图片存放在私人仓库中,而你又试图在公共网页或其他地方引用这些图片,则可能会遇到权限问题,导致图片无法加载。请确认你的图片权限是否正确设置。
文件路径错误
确保图片的路径正确。如果文件夹或文件名存在拼写错误,或路径不正确,也会导致图片加载失败。GitHub对大小写敏感,确保路径与实际情况完全一致。
文件格式不支持
GitHub支持多种图片格式,如PNG、JPG、GIF等,但某些特殊格式可能不被支持。如果使用了不常见的图片格式,也可能导致加载失败。
GitHub Pages 配置问题
如果你使用GitHub Pages发布网页,可能会因为配置不当而导致图片加载问题。需要检查你的GitHub Pages设置,确保一切配置正常。
解决方案
检查权限设置
- 确认你的仓库是否为公共仓库,或将需要公开的图片移到公共仓库中。
- 检查仓库的访问权限,确保所有用户可以访问相关文件。
确认文件路径
- 使用相对路径引用图片,确保路径拼写无误。
- 如果在代码中引用,务必确认路径与文件名的大小写完全一致。
使用支持的文件格式
- 避免使用不常见的图片格式,尽量使用PNG或JPG等主流格式。
- 进行图片格式转换,使用在线工具将图片转换为支持的格式。
配置 GitHub Pages
- 确认你的GitHub Pages设置是否正确,包括主分支的选择和发布设置。
- 尝试清除缓存,有时浏览器的缓存可能导致图片无法加载。
常见问题解答
1. 为什么我的GitHub页面上的图片总是加载不出来?
可能是由于权限设置、文件路径错误或文件格式不支持等原因。请逐项检查,确保没有错误。
2. 如何检查GitHub仓库的权限设置?
在仓库的Settings(设置)中,选择Manage Access(管理访问),确认你的权限设置是否正确。
3. GitHub支持哪些图片格式?
GitHub支持多种图片格式,主要包括PNG、JPG、GIF等,尽量使用这些主流格式来避免问题。
4. 如何正确配置GitHub Pages?
在仓库的Settings中,找到Pages选项,确保主分支和发布目录正确选择并配置。
5. 如何查看加载失败的图片链接?
使用浏览器的开发者工具,查看控制台中的错误信息,可以找到加载失败的具体链接和原因。
总结
遇到GitHub中图片加载不出来的问题,首先要找到具体原因,依照本指南中的解决方案进行操作。通过检查权限、文件路径及格式,合理配置GitHub Pages,绝大部分问题都可以得到解决。如果仍有疑问,请参考常见问题解答部分,或在GitHub社区中寻求帮助。